Commit Message

Hannu Heikkinen Oct. 14, 2012, 9:43 a.m. UTC
Use the devres managed resource functions in the probe routine.
Also affects the remove routine where the previously used free and
release functions are not needed.

The devm_* functions eliminate the need for manual resource releasing and
simplify error handling.  Resources allocated by devm_* are freed
automatically on driver detach.

Signed-off-by: Hannu Heikkinen <hannuxx@iki.fi>
---
 drivers/rtc/rtc-davinci.c | 56 +++++++++++++----------------------------------
 1 file changed, 15 insertions(+), 41 deletions(-)

diff mbox

Patch

diff --git a/drivers/rtc/rtc-davinci.c b/drivers/rtc/rtc-davinci.c
index 14c2109..d24b573 100644
--- a/drivers/rtc/rtc-davinci.c
+++ b/drivers/rtc/rtc-davinci.c
@@ -119,8 +119,6 @@  static DEFINE_SPINLOCK(davinci_rtc_lock);
 struct davinci_rtc {
 	struct rtc_device 		*rtc;
 	void __iomem			*base;
-	resource_size_t			pbase;
-	size_t				base_size;
 	int				irq;
 };
 
@@ -482,22 +480,16 @@  static int __init davinci_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 {
 	struct device *dev = &pdev->dev;
 	struct davinci_rtc *davinci_rtc;
-	struct resource *res, *mem;
+	struct resource *res;
 	int ret = 0;
 
-	davinci_rtc = kzalloc(sizeof(struct davinci_rtc), GFP_KERNEL);
+	davinci_rtc = devm_kzalloc(&pdev->dev, sizeof(struct davinci_rtc),
+		GFP_KERNEL);
 	if (!davinci_rtc) {
 		dev_dbg(dev, "could not allocate memory for private data\n");
 		return -ENOMEM;
 	}
 
-	davinci_rtc->irq = platform_get_irq(pdev, 0);
-	if (davinci_rtc->irq < 0) {
-		dev_err(dev, "no RTC irq\n");
-		ret = davinci_rtc->irq;
-		goto fail1;
-	}
-
 	res = platform_get_resource(pdev, IORESOURCE_MEM, 0);
 	if (!res) {
 		dev_err(dev, "no mem resource\n");
@@ -505,23 +497,16 @@  static int __init davinci_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 		goto fail1;
 	}
 
-	davinci_rtc->pbase = res->start;
-	davinci_rtc->base_size = resource_size(res);
-
-	mem = request_mem_region(davinci_rtc->pbase, davinci_rtc->base_size,
-				 pdev->name);
-	if (!mem) {
-		dev_err(dev, "RTC registers at %08x are not free\n",
-			davinci_rtc->pbase);
-		ret = -EBUSY;
-		goto fail1;
+	davinci_rtc->base = devm_request_and_ioremap(&pdev->dev, res);
+	if (!davinci_rtc->base) {
+		dev_err(&pdev->dev, "Unable to request mem region and grab IOs for device.\n");
+		return -EBUSY;
 	}
 
-	davinci_rtc->base = ioremap(davinci_rtc->pbase, davinci_rtc->base_size);
-	if (!davinci_rtc->base) {
-		dev_err(dev, "unable to ioremap MEM resource\n");
-		ret = -ENOMEM;
-		goto fail2;
+	davinci_rtc->irq = platform_get_irq(pdev, 0);
+	if (davinci_rtc->irq < 0) {
+		dev_err(dev, "no RTC irq\n");
+		return davinci_rtc->irq;
 	}
 
 	platform_set_drvdata(pdev, davinci_rtc);
@@ -529,9 +514,10 @@  static int __init davinci_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	davinci_rtc->rtc = rtc_device_register(pdev->name, &pdev->dev,
 				    &davinci_rtc_ops, THIS_MODULE);
 	if (IS_ERR(davinci_rtc->rtc)) {
+		ret = PTR_ERR(davinci_rtc->rtc);
 		dev_err(dev, "unable to register RTC device, err %ld\n",
 				PTR_ERR(davinci_rtc->rtc));
-		goto fail3;
+		return ret;
 	}
 
 	rtcif_write(davinci_rtc, PRTCIF_INTFLG_RTCSS, PRTCIF_INTFLG);
@@ -545,7 +531,7 @@  static int __init davinci_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 			  0, "davinci_rtc", davinci_rtc);
 	if (ret < 0) {
 		dev_err(dev, "unable to register davinci RTC interrupt\n");
-		goto fail4;
+		goto err_dev_unreg;
 	}
 
 	/* Enable interrupts */
@@ -559,15 +545,8 @@  static int __init davinci_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 
 	return 0;
 
-fail4:
+err_dev_unreg:
 	rtc_device_unregister(davinci_rtc->rtc);
-fail3:
-	platform_set_drvdata(pdev, NULL);
-	iounmap(davinci_rtc->base);
-fail2:
-	release_mem_region(davinci_rtc->pbase, davinci_rtc->base_size);
-fail1:
-	kfree(davinci_rtc);
 
 	return ret;
 }
@@ -584,13 +563,8 @@  static int __devexit davinci_rtc_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
 
 	rtc_device_unregister(davinci_rtc->rtc);
 
-	iounmap(davinci_rtc->base);
-	release_mem_region(davinci_rtc->pbase, davinci_rtc->base_size);
-
 	platform_set_drvdata(pdev, NULL);
 
-	kfree(davinci_rtc);
-
 	return 0;
 }
